One of the things that chemists and astrochemists have been doing for the past 70 years is understanding chemical reactions. The idea that nucleosynthesis of elements in the universe comes naturally from the stellar lifecycle (and from the Big Bang) comes straight from observations that scientists have been gathering from laboratories right here on earth.

We can tell exactly the composition of the Sun and other stars from their spectra obtained through telescopes, and those observations are well known, having been directly observed in labs all over the planet back in the 1920's and 30s (indeed, they can now be verified in labs that are taught in Astro 101 class in every College and University on the planet, and in an exhibit in the Nat'l Air and Space Museum in DC). We know all about what exists between here and the sun because we have had satellites such as SOHO and other satellites observing the Sun and the planets at every concievable direction that you can think of. We can use physics and chemistry obtained experimentally along with basic observables (like density and temperature) to determine boundary conditions of the environment at the surface of the Sun. With that and a knowledge of what fusion reactions are possible at what range of temperatures (which are derived from theoretical physics and chemistry), it's pretty simple to understand what's going on inside a star, and much of the work was done in this field long before the development of the modern personal computer (i.e. before 1975). A Nobel Prize in Physics was given to Willam Fowler in 1983 for his work done in this field back in the 40's and 50's This stuff is about as well known as you can get without actually building a star in your backyard.
